Wire Mesh Applications: From Construction to Art
Wire mesh provides a surprisingly broad range of applications, extending far beyond its traditional role in construction and infrastructure. While it remains a crucial component for reinforcing concrete structures, fencing, and sieving materials, wire mesh has also emerged as an innovative material in the realm of art and design. Artists utilize the inherent texture and strength of wire mesh to create detailed sculptures,wall installations, and even wearable pieces. The malleability of wire mesh allows for fluid shapes, while its open structure creates a sense of transparency. Wire Mesh: A Versatile Material
Wire mesh is a incredibly renowned material with a wide range of purposes. Its durability and adaptability make it an ideal choice for countless projects. From construction, to separation, wire mesh plays a vital role in our daily lives. Whether you need a durable barrier or a precise sieve, there is a variety of wire mesh to satisfy your specific needs.
- Various common uses for wire mesh include:
- Infrastructure: Reinforcing concrete, creating safety barriers
- Manufacturing: Conveying materials, protecting equipment
- Farming: Protecting crops from pests, making animal cages
- Separation: Removing impurities from liquids or gases
